Colombia: August 9, 2002

Archives

In the north, turf battles between leftist FARC and ELN versus rightist AUC have left at least fifty dead. The battle over this region, 700 kilometers north of the capital, has been going on for three years. FARC rejected an offer by the Untied Nations to mediate it's disputes with the government.
